Re: [PATCH 1/5] net/cadence: get rid of HAVE_NET_MACB

From: Joachim Eastwood <hidden>
Date: 2012-10-21 20:26:34
Also in: linux-arm-kernel

On Sun, Oct 21, 2012 at 8:30 PM, Jean-Christophe PLAGNIOL-VILLARD
[off-list ref] wrote:
On 16:23 Sun 21 Oct     , Joachim Eastwood wrote:
quoted
macb is a platform driver and there is nothing that prevents
this driver from being built on non-ARM/AVR32 platforms.
if you want to drop the HAVE_NET_MACB you need to drop it everywher in one
patch
Breaking it up in several patches doesn't seem to cause any build
failures and I did this in case the patches were going into different
git trees.
